Cesar Chavez Luncheon 2010
The local mariachi group known as Miriachi Pancho Villa sang“Las Mañanitas”, as the Farmworker Coordinating Council commenced its annual celebration of Cesar Chavez Day. The celebration was held on March 31st, 2010 with a luncheon at Compass Community Center in Lake Worth.
There was plenty of food, music and a guest speaker was featured: Dr. Robert Watson, professor of American Studies at Lynn University. Dr. Watson passionately spoke about the life and legacy of Cesar Chavez, the great farm worker advocate and leader who dedicated his life to improve working conditions for farm workers across the US.
Mexican songs and rhythms had guests singing & dancing with delicious Latin food, courtesy of Sedano’s Supermarkets.
Several donors & supporters were recognized for their outstanding contributions: Mr. & Mrs. Keith & Yvette Lane, Edwards Angell Palmer & Dodge LLP, attorneys at law and Sedano’s Supermarkets.
More than 80 guests, staff, Board Members and community leaders attended the luncheon including City of Lake Worth Commission Jennings. This was the second year that the agency celebrated Cesar Chavez Day.
